Is 2-Amino-5-nitrophenol a carcinogen according to IARC?

2-Amino-5-nitrophenol is classified by IARC as Group 3 — not classifiable as to its carcinogenicity to humans (evaluated 1992). Source: IARC Monographs on the Identification of Carcinogenic Hazards to Humans.
